Did you know that kids can play in organized soccer as young as 2.5? Just because it starts at 2 ½, though, doesn’t mean that’s when every child starts playing – you can join in on the fun anytime between ages 2.5 – 18.  Whether you’re 2.5, 10, or 16, when you sign up to play soccer, you are signing up for so much more.

As a new mom to a 1-year old, I often catch myself thinking about what traits I want my daughter to have as she grows up. I, like all of you, think about a long and seemingly endless list: we want our children to be confident, have good social skills, be healthy & active, cope with failure, be accountable, be motivated, be disciplined, have respect for themselves & others and so on and so forth. Honestly, as a new parent, this is often overwhelming and daunting to think about, especially when I wonder “how am I supposed to help her have all of these traits?”. The good news - it’s not just up to me or any of us.

Soccer, for me, is one place I know I’ll turn to when my daughter is of age to help foster positive development in her. I started playing recreation soccer when I was 8 at NCFC Youth (formerly Capital Area Soccer League), and I stuck with the sport for the next two decades as a player, coach, and now full-time professional. As a product of the game, I know that laundry list of good traits I want for my daughter can be learned and/or reinforced through soccer and the people (teammates, coaches, referees, opponents) and experiences that come from it. Soccer has shaped me into the person I am today, and I look forward to the day when my daughter gets the chance to participate.
